OK to scan archives in Time Machine backups with antivirus?

Without my knowing it, my antivirus program (VirusBarrier) scanned my Time Machine backups. Since I had it set to scan archives (such as zip files), it would have decompressed them, which I'm concerned might modify them somehow. And since Time Machine backups should not be changed, would scanning archives cause the Time Machine backups to become corrupted or less reliable?

I'm not familiar with VirusBarrier but if you manually run a backup (click symbol on top menu and say run backup now), do you get any errors or delays? If you want to be safe and don't mind erasing the disk and doing another full backup, then I would say go for it. If you want to keep it because it has your only path back to ML or something else you could need, then just verify that it is running "OK" for now.


You can always try to retrieve something really old from it to verify you can.
